Educational Approach and Career Program
Career Program
We offer our students admitted to the Department of Artificial Intelligence Engineering a career program that goes beyond a scholarship. This program is built on four core pillars extending from the preparatory year to doctoral studies.
- 1 Language and Vision Pillar
- 2 Education Pillar
- 3 Undergraduate Specialization Pillar
- 4 Doctoral Education Pillar
1
Language and Vision Pillar
We aim to equip our students with both advanced proficiency in English and a global vision. Students who begin their language education in the first semester of the preparatory year with the support of our native-English-speaking instructors take the first steps of their career planning through company visits and weekly research meetings.
The most important part of this pillar is the five-month study-abroad language program in the spring semester. Depending on their visa status, students receive education at select schools in the following countries:
During this process, students observe globally relevant problems being worked on by visiting companies and research centers in the countries where they are staying. Tuition, accommodation and transportation expenses are entirely covered by our university.
2
Education Pillar
Having completed their language education, our students receive both theoretical and practical training on our campus through laboratory-intensive courses, working with top-tier equipment in AI-based courses.
Students who become involved in research projects starting from the preparatory year develop their practical experience through summer internships at partner institutions. They also gain national and international experience through the events they organize:
Artificial Intelligence Day Conference
Fall Semester
Artificial Intelligence Hackathon
Spring Semester
Medipol Science Olympiads
Mathematics, chemistry, biology
3
Undergraduate Specialization Pillar
Students choose to specialize either in the subject of their research projects or in a new field, and carry out their academic internships abroad accordingly. Students who are unable to secure admission abroad are placed at the leading partner institutions with which we have agreements:
Accommodation, transportation and meal expenses during the internship are covered by our university. Students are expected to publish at the Q1 level as part of their capstone projects and overseas internships—previous students have successfully achieved this goal, even appearing as first authors in the journal Nature.
Students who complete their capstone project may continue their careers in industry, start their own company, or proceed to the fourth stage of the program.
4
Doctoral Education Pillar
For our students who apply for doctoral programs in the Fall semester of their fourth year, receiving direct admission abroad is a common outcome. Students who wish may also obtain a master's degree from our university through the integrated master's pathway.
Our students with Q1 publications and project experience, particularly those who interned with overseas researchers in the summer of their third year, may receive doctoral admission from those same researchers.
Additional Award
Aziz Sancar Doctoral Scholarship — Doctoral admission must be fully funded, from a university ranked in the top 50 of the Times Higher Education World University Rankings. If the amount of the overseas scholarship is below 40,000 US dollars per year, our university completes the amount up to 40,000 dollars.
The process lasts four years and is expected to be completed within that period. Students whose scholarship amount exceeds 40,000 dollars are offered an annual conference support of 5,000 US dollars.
